A certified LCA means the Department of Labor accepted the employer's labor-condition filing. It does not mean USCIS approved an H1B petition.

What is the average H1B salary for News Analysts, Reporters, and Journalists in Los Angeles, CA?

The average wage listed for News Analysts, Reporters, and Journalists in Los Angeles, CA is $114,022, based on 3 historical LCA records from FY2020–FY2025 Q3.

How does News Analysts, Reporters, and Journalists salary in Los Angeles compare to the national average?

News Analysts, Reporters, and Journalists H1B salaries in Los Angeles are 49.5% above the national average of $76,291.
